ABOUT THE STARS
• The Stars dropped its only exhibition of the season 81-40 at Texas A&M on Friday in College Station, Texas
• NaShyla Hammons, a 6-foot junior from Oklahoma City, had seven points for OCU on Friday. She turned in 8.3 points, 6.7 rebounds, 2.3 assists and 1.41 steals a contest last season
• Taylor Sylvester, a 6-5 junior from Chickasha, Okla., picked up seven points, four rebounds and a blocked shot against the Aggies. Sylvester joined the Stars after being an all-Oklahoma Collegiate Athletic Conference choice with Northern Oklahoma-Enid
• Taylor LaCour, a 6-1 senior from Georgetown, Texas, became a third-team all-SAC selection as well as all-tournament in the SAC Tournament while producing 12.4 points and 5.5 rebounds a game last season
• Oklahoma City sits at 10th in the preseason NAIA Division I rankings. The Stars reached the NAIA Tournament for the 21st consecutive year and for the 24th time overall last season. OCU has captured nine national championships in 1988, 1999, 2000, 2001, 2002, 2012, 2014, 2015 and 2017
• The Stars picked up the second spot in the Sooner Athletic Conference preseason coaches poll. OCU took its 18th SAC regular-season championship and 12th SAC Tournament title last season
• OCU owns a 4-0 all-time record against Paul Quinn. The Stars have topped 100 points in three of those meetings

MEET THE COACHES
Bo Overton (82-17, fourth season with OCU)
• Led Stars to 28-6 season with the SAC regular-season and tournament crowns in 2017-18
• Overton has coached four all-Americans while at OCU, including Daniela Wallen, the 2017 NAIA Division I player of the year, and Daniela Galindo, the 2018 WBCA NAIA player of the year
• Overton served as an assistant coach for the Chinese national team in the 2012 Olympics
• From 1998-2004, he served as assistant for Oklahoma. During that time, the Sooners made five NCAA Tournament trips with the 2002 NCAA runner-up finish and Final Four berth with three Big 12 regular-season titles and two conference tournament crowns
